Understanding Pradhan Mantri Fasal Bima Yojana (PMFBY): Benefits and Implementation
| Aspect | Details |
|---|---|
| Scheme | Pradhan Mantri Fasal Bima Yojana (PMFBY) |
| Launch | Kharif 2016 season by the Ministry of Agriculture & Farmers Welfare, New Delhi |
| Beneficiaries (2022-23) | 3,49,633 farmers |
| **Benefits Provided (2022-23) | ₹563 crore |
| Enrollment (Andhra Pradesh) | 1.23 crore (2022-23) and 1.31 crore (2023-24) |
| Premium Details (5 seasons) | Farmers share: ₹453 crores; State/Central Govt subsidy: ₹1909 crores; Gross Premium: ₹2362 crores |
| Farmers Covered (5 seasons) | 70,27,637 farmers |
| Claims Paid (First 3 seasons) | ₹1703 crores to 17,66,455 farmers |
| Implementation Basis | 'Area Approach' basis for widespread calamities; Individual farm basis for localised risks |
| Key Features | Voluntary for States and farmers; Claims processed via Digiclaim on National Crop Insurance Portal |
| Andhra Pradesh | Re-joined the scheme from Kharif 2022 after opting out in Kharif 2020 |
| Localised Risks | Hailstorm, landslide, inundation, cloud burst, natural fire, post-harvest losses |
| Claim Intimation | Farmers must intimate loss within 72 hours; assessed by joint committee (State Govt & insurer) |
